"
I had to lie to my boss to buy social peace
." Étienne, 31, shudders when he tells his story. For six months, his boss has "
put pressure
" on him to be vaccinated. What he refused from the start. "
I don't see the point, I am young and the vaccine does not prevent the transmission of the virus
," he says. After being summoned several times to his superior's office, Étienne ended up lying to him. "
I told him that I was going to be vaccinated the following weekend, but since then I caught the covid and I finally have a health pass
." Despite an important case of conscience, he prefers "
not to be pissed off
" at his workplace.
